Transaction 99ca019158ef206a15786da51f34994d2193b571247aa04ad79581def7cba290
1 Input
1 Output
-
99ca019158ef206a15786da51f34994d2193b571247aa04ad79581def7cba290:0
- value
- 61000
- script pubkey
- OP_0 OP_PUSHBYTES_20 6e3b3d66309c38fb42ff654f1f613f588fb1df0b
- address
- bc1qdcan6e3snsu0kshlv4837cfltz8mrhct2fd8an